Spring Things

Okay, it will be the first day of Spring next week (March 21st) and it is definitely time to get my wardobe together. So this weekend I will be doing the following:

1. Transitioning my winter wardrobe out and getting rid of the things that I did not wear the past season.

2. Assessing my Spring/Summer wardrobe from last year and making a list of things that I
need (ha!)

3. Deciding which colors/items/trends that I am willing to participate in. I look at my magazines and tear out pictures and colors that I like, but I am not a slave to trends. Decide what works with your personal style and add some trendy things but don't go overboard. Accessories are a great way to update your look.

4. For every new item you buy, get rid of something. I used to jam my closet with all my clothes and not get rid of anything and I would get so frustrated because I couldn't find anything to wear. But the problem was that I had too many options, streamline your wardrobe so that you can see what's in your closet.

5. Only buy things that you
LOVE. Even if an item is on sale, love it or leave it. By the time that you buy ten $20 items that were on sale, you could have bought that $200 bag that you thought was too expensive but fell in love with.

Layer cake



I want to learn to layer. There. I've put it out there, I DON'T KNOW HOW! I can wear a shirt underneath a jacket, but my look is more streamlined than layered and casual. I want to be able to wear a fitted shirt underneath a dress or a cute top and not feel foolish. Or a dress with pants underneath or a crisp button down long sleeve shirt underneath a short knit dress. Here are some tips that I am going to try and for the other "layering impaired"

Balance: If you layer on top, keep it simple and fitted on the bottom. Also, don't wear chunky tops over a chunky bottom, you will look, well chunky.

Color: Try to keep the colors in the same family or monochromatic. You can also play with textures and patterns but not too much, you don't want to look too "busy."

Layering options:

Short sleeve tee over a long (white) sleeve tee
Floaty top underneath a chunky cardigan
Short skirt with tights or patterned hose

Clear as a bell


The Chanel "Naked" bag"

I guess designers are hoping this clear thing catches on because now clear pvc and lucite are popping up on high end retailers' shelves. Karl Lagerfield created a sensation with his "Naked" bag at the Chanel shows and other designers have caught the transparency bug, from brands like Dolce & Gabbana, Manolo and Fendi. Some fashionistas who are willing to pay for the high end bags and shoes say that it's easier for them to find things in the totes because of the clear looks and it's also a symbol of having up to the minute trends in high style.
